I suggest a combination of indoor tagging, like described on this page: https://wiki.openstreetmap.org/wiki/Simple_Indoor_Tagging
and a custom tag, like library_section=* (or maybe book_type=*, because this could also be used in book shops). So a room with children books would be indoor=room + book_type=children.
